“As of March 18, 2026, the Ford is withdrawing from the Red Sea after suffering a fire in its laundry area that injured sailors and damaged over 100 berths. It is now heading to Souda Bay, Crete, for repairs, taking it out of active operations. The USS George H.W. Bush is preparing to relieve it in the Middle East.”

“The USS Gerald R. Ford has been on station for nearly 10 months as of mid-March 2026, with its deployment expected to extend into May 2026, potentially reaching 11 months at sea. This would surpass the post-Vietnam War record of 294 days set by the USS Abraham Lincoln.

Extended Deployment Timeline:
The carrier departed Norfolk on June 24, 2025, and was initially expected to complete a standard 6- to 8-month deployment. However, due to heightened tensions and ongoing military operations involving Iran, its mission was extended twice. “
